Best Hotel Bars in NOLA

New Orleans does hotel bars exceptionally well. The Best Hotels Bars in NOLA are not just places to grab a drink before dinner; they are destinations in themselves, full of music, history, gorgeous design, and that only-in-New-Orleans sense of occasion.

From grand French Quarter classics to Garden District charm and glamorous lobby bars, these are the best hotel bars in NOLA.

The Carousel Bar is one of the most famous hotel bars in New Orleans, and yes, it is touristy, but it is also fabulous. The rotating bar, the French Quarter setting, and the old-school glamour all make it a must.

Go early if you want a seat at the carousel itself, order a classic cocktail, and enjoy the show. It is one of those experiences that feels playful, iconic, and totally NOLA. 214 Royal St, New Orleans, LA 70130

Chandelier Bar at Four Seasons Hotel New Orleans

Chandelier Bar at the Four Seasons is one of the most beautiful hotel bars in the city. It is glamorous, elegant, and centered around a stunning chandelier that makes the whole space feel like a sparkling New Orleans jewel box. This is where to go when you want polished cocktails, a luxe atmosphere, and a chic start or finish to the evening. 2 Canal St, New Orleans, LA 70130

The Columns

The Columns is a Garden District classic and one of the prettiest hotel bars in New Orleans. Set inside a historic mansion on St. Charles Avenue, it has that dreamy porch, gorgeous interiors, and a timeless Southern feel.

Come for cocktails on the veranda, stay for the architecture, and enjoy a slower, more romantic side of New Orleans. 3811 St Charles Ave, New Orleans, LA 70115

The Davenport Lounge at The Ritz-Carlton, New Orleans

The Davenport Lounge at The Ritz-Carlton is a classic New Orleans hotel bar with live jazz from Jeremy Davenport. It is elegant, musical, and a perfect choice when you want a cocktail with a little old-school glamour.

This is a lovely stop for martinis, champagne, and live music in a polished French Quarter setting. 921 Canal St, New Orleans, LA 70112

Hotel Monteleone

Hotel Monteleone is one of the great historic hotels of New Orleans, and even beyond the Carousel Bar, the whole property has that grand French Quarter energy. It is literary, glamorous, and full of history.

If you are doing a hotel bar crawl, this is an essential stop. It captures the classic New Orleans hotel experience beautifully. 214 Royal St, New Orleans, LA 70130

Hotel Saint Vincent

Hotel Saint Vincent is one of the most stylish hotel stops in New Orleans. The whole property feels design-forward, glamorous, and a little unexpected, with several places to eat and drink depending on your mood. I have stayed here and it’s fabulous! Come for the atmosphere, stay for cocktails at Paradise Lounge or Chapel Club, and enjoy a very chic Lower Garden District moment. 1507 Magazine St, New Orleans, LA 70130

JW Marriott New Orleans

JW Marriott New Orleans is a convenient French Quarter-adjacent hotel stop for a polished cocktail before heading out into the city. It is especially useful if you want something central, comfortable, and easy before dinner or a night on Bourbon, Royal, or Canal.

It may not be the quirkiest bar in town, but it is a reliable hotel-bar option with a prime location. 614 Canal St, New Orleans, LA 70130

The best hotel bars in New Orleans each offer their own kind of magic. Some are grand and historic, some are polished and glamorous, and some are tucked inside beautifully restored properties that feel like their own little world. Whether you are sipping under a chandelier, listening to Jeremy Davenport at The Ritz, or having a cocktail on the porch at The Columns, a great NOLA hotel bar always feels like part of the trip.
